/** * v0.41.13 (#1433) — re-sync preserves previously-indexed metafile pages. * * Bug class (infiniteGameExp): a domain `log.md` page that was indexed by * an older gbrain version (back when isSyncable() didn't filter `log.md`) * or via a direct put_page was being deleted on every subsequent * `gbrain sync --skip-failed` because the cleanup loop at * commands/sync.ts:772 treated all unsyncable-modified paths the same. * * Fix: the cleanup loop skips the delete when `unsyncableReason(path)` * returns `'metafile'`. Pages stay in the index for the lifetime they * were originally indexed. * * This is the IRON-RULE regression test for #1433.
